According to ePAPR this should be a generic name (page 19); For example the i2c node name should be "i2c@address" instead of "omap3-i2c@address". There is no recommended generic term for an image signal processor, "isp" looks ok to me and seems to be already used in NVIDIA Tegra's device tree files.
